Windows Server 2019安装图形界面的方法与建议
结论与核心观点
Windows Server 2019默认支持图形界面(GUI)和服务器核心(Server Core)两种安装模式。若需安装或恢复图形界面,可通过以下方法实现,但需注意服务器核心模式更轻量、更安全,建议非必要不安装GUI。
安装图形界面的方法
1. 初始安装时选择带GUI的版本
在安装Windows Server 2019时,系统会提示选择安装类型:
- 带GUI的服务器(Server with Desktop Experience):完整图形界面,类似Windows 10。
- 服务器核心(Server Core):无图形界面,仅命令行和PowerShell。
建议:若需图形化管理工具,直接选择“带GUI的服务器”版本,避免后续切换的麻烦。
2. 从Server Core模式添加GUI(已安装无GUI版本时)
如果已安装Server Core,可通过PowerShell命令添加GUI功能:
Install-WindowsFeature Server-Gui-Mgmt-Infra,Server-Gui-Shell -Restart
关键点:
- 需要联网或加载安装源(如ISO或WSUS)。
- 完成后系统会自动重启。
3. 从GUI模式移除图形界面(降级为Server Core)
若需减少资源占用,可卸载GUI:
Uninstall-WindowsFeature Server-Gui-Mgmt-Infra,Server-Gui-Shell -Restart
注意事项
- 资源占用:GUI会显著增加内存和CPU消耗(约1-2GB内存),推荐仅用于测试或特殊管理需求。
- 安全性:图形界面增加攻击面,Server Core模式更安全。
- 替代方案:
- 使用远程服务器管理工具(RSAT)从本地PC管理服务器。
- 通过PowerShell Remoting或Windows Admin Center实现无GUI管理。
总结
- 优先选择Server Core:除非必须使用图形工具,否则推荐默认安装Server Core。
- GUI可按需增减:通过PowerShell命令灵活切换,但需重启生效。
- 管理替代方案:现代服务器管理趋向命令行和远程工具,图形界面并非必需。
最终建议:除非应用程序强制依赖GUI,否则应遵循微软最佳实践,使用Server Core提升性能和安全性。